

















Antique 18th century oil on canvas painting, depicting the holy family
An 18th-century oil on canvas painting, attributed to the Continental School, depicting the Holy Family. This enduring Christian theme presents the Virgin Mary, Infant Jesus, and St. Joseph, a devotional image central to European religious art.
The subject of the Holy Family became increasingly popular from the late Middle Ages into the Renaissance, serving both as an object of devotion and a reflection of familial unity. This composition embodies the emotional resonance of the Gospel narrative, intended to inspire contemplation and piety.
The large scale and warm palette of the work suggest it may have originally been created for display in a chapel or private devotional space.
